- Notifications
You must be signed in to change notification settings - Fork 15.3k
Pull requests: llvm/llvm-project
Author
Label
Projects
Milestones
Reviews
Assignee
Sort
Pull requests list
[clang] Refactor to remove clangDriver dependency from clangFrontend and flangFrontend backend:AArch64 backend:AMDGPU backend:ARM backend:CSKY backend:Hexagon backend:loongarch backend:MIPS backend:PowerPC backend:RISC-V backend:Sparc backend:SPIR-V backend:SystemZ backend:X86 bazel "Peripheral" support tier build system: utils/bazel clang:as-a-library libclang and C++ API clang:driver 'clang' and 'clang++' user-facing binaries. Not 'clang-cl' clang:frontend Language frontend issues, e.g. anything involving "Sema" clang:modules C++20 modules and Clang Header Modules clang:openmp OpenMP related changes to Clang clang Clang issues not falling into any other category clang-tools-extra clangd flang:driver flang Flang issues not falling into any other category lldb llvm:mc Machine (object) code
#165277 by naveen-seth was merged Nov 23, 2025 Loading… updated Nov 29, 2025
[RISCV] Intrinsic Support for XCVelw backend:RISC-V llvm:ir llvm:mc Machine (object) code
#129168 by realqhc was merged Nov 29, 2025 Loading… updated Nov 29, 2025
[dwarf] make dwarf fission compatible with RISCV relaxations backend:RISC-V clang:driver 'clang' and 'clang++' user-facing binaries. Not 'clang-cl' clang:frontend Language frontend issues, e.g. anything involving "Sema" clang Clang issues not falling into any other category debuginfo llvm:codegen llvm:mc Machine (object) code
#164128 by daniilavdeev was closed Nov 28, 2025 Loading… updated Nov 28, 2025
CodeGen: Remove PointerLikeRegClass handling from codegen backend:AMDGPU backend:SystemZ llvm:codegen llvm:globalisel llvm:mc Machine (object) code llvm:SelectionDAG SelectionDAGISel as well tablegen tools:llvm-exegesis
#159883 by arsenm was merged Nov 26, 2025 Loading… updated Nov 26, 2025
CodeGen: Make target overrides of PointerLikeRegClass mandatory backend:AMDGPU backend:SystemZ llvm:codegen llvm:globalisel llvm:mc Machine (object) code llvm:SelectionDAG SelectionDAGISel as well tablegen
#159882 by arsenm was merged Nov 26, 2025 Loading… updated Nov 26, 2025
CodeGen: Make all targets override pseudos with pointers backend:AArch64 backend:AMDGPU backend:ARM backend:CSKY backend:DirectX backend:Hexagon backend:Lanai backend:loongarch backend:m68k backend:MIPS backend:MSP430 backend:NVPTX backend:PowerPC backend:RISC-V backend:Sparc backend:SPIR-V backend:SystemZ backend:WebAssembly backend:X86 backend:Xtensa llvm:codegen llvm:globalisel llvm:mc Machine (object) code llvm:SelectionDAG SelectionDAGISel as well tablegen
#159881 by arsenm was merged Nov 26, 2025 Loading… updated Nov 26, 2025
opt: Try to respect target-abi command line option backend:MIPS llvm:mc Machine (object) code tools:opt
#169604 by arsenm was merged Nov 26, 2025 Loading… updated Nov 26, 2025
[dwarf] make dwarf fission compatible with RISCV relaxations 1/2 backend:RISC-V debuginfo llvm:codegen llvm:mc Machine (object) code
#166597 by daniilavdeev was merged Nov 25, 2025 Loading… updated Nov 25, 2025
Revert "[MC] Use a variant to hold MCCFIInstruction state (NFC)" llvm:mc Machine (object) code
#169442 by Kewen12 was merged Nov 25, 2025 Loading… updated Nov 25, 2025
Add support for the .base64 directive (fixes #165499) llvm:mc Machine (object) code
#165549 by kenballus was merged Nov 17, 2025 Loading… updated Nov 19, 2025
[NFC][MC] Namespace cleanup in MC backend:WebAssembly llvm:mc Machine (object) code
#168627 by jurahul was merged Nov 19, 2025 Loading… updated Nov 19, 2025
TableGen: Support target specialized pseudoinstructions backend:AMDGPU backend:SystemZ llvm:codegen llvm:globalisel llvm:mc Machine (object) code llvm:SelectionDAG SelectionDAGISel as well tablegen
#159880 by arsenm was merged Nov 19, 2025 Loading… updated Nov 19, 2025
[MC] AsmLexer assert buffer is null-terminated at CurBuf.end() llvm:mc Machine (object) code
#154972 by smilczek was merged Nov 18, 2025 Loading… updated Nov 18, 2025
[MC] Use MCRegister::id() to avoid implicit casts. NFC llvm:mc Machine (object) code
#168233 by topperc was merged Nov 17, 2025 Loading… updated Nov 17, 2025
[MC] Remove a redundant cast (NFC) llvm:mc Machine (object) code
#168298 by kazutakahirata was merged Nov 17, 2025 Loading… updated Nov 17, 2025
[CodeGen] Turn MCRegUnit into an enum class (NFC) backend:AMDGPU backend:X86 llvm:codegen llvm:mc Machine (object) code llvm:regalloc
#167943 by s-barannikov was merged Nov 16, 2025 Loading… updated Nov 16, 2025
[MC] Remove a redundant cast (NFC) llvm:mc Machine (object) code
#168013 by kazutakahirata was merged Nov 14, 2025 Loading… updated Nov 14, 2025
[CodeGen] Add TRI::regunits() iterating over all register units (NFC) llvm:codegen llvm:mc Machine (object) code llvm:regalloc
#167901 by s-barannikov was merged Nov 13, 2025 Loading… updated Nov 13, 2025
Remove unused standard headers: memory, unordered_* backend:AArch64 backend:DirectX backend:Hexagon backend:m68k backend:MIPS backend:PowerPC backend:RISC-V backend:Sparc backend:SPIR-V backend:X86 debuginfo llvm:adt llvm:analysis Includes value tracking, cost tables and constant folding llvm:binary-utilities llvm:codegen llvm:ir llvm:mc Machine (object) code llvm:support llvm:transforms mlgo objectyaml PGO Profile Guided Optimizations platform:windows tablegen tools:llvm-exegesis tools:llvm-mca xray
#167297 by serge-sans-paille was merged Nov 12, 2025 Loading… updated Nov 12, 2025
[MachO] Report error when there are too many sections llvm:mc Machine (object) code
#167418 by Prabhuk was merged Nov 11, 2025 Loading… updated Nov 12, 2025
[CodeGen] Use MCRegUnit in more places (NFC) llvm:codegen llvm:mc Machine (object) code llvm:regalloc
#167578 by s-barannikov was merged Nov 11, 2025 Loading… updated Nov 11, 2025
[clang] Refactor option-related code from clangDriver into new clangOptions library backend:AArch64 backend:AMDGPU backend:ARM backend:CSKY backend:Hexagon backend:loongarch backend:MIPS backend:PowerPC backend:RISC-V backend:Sparc backend:SPIR-V backend:SystemZ backend:X86 bazel "Peripheral" support tier build system: utils/bazel clang:driver 'clang' and 'clang++' user-facing binaries. Not 'clang-cl' clang:frontend Language frontend issues, e.g. anything involving "Sema" clang:openmp OpenMP related changes to Clang clang Clang issues not falling into any other category clang-tools-extra clangd flang:driver flang Flang issues not falling into any other category lldb llvm:mc Machine (object) code
#163659 by naveen-seth was merged Nov 10, 2025 Loading… updated Nov 11, 2025
Reland "[clang] Refactor option-related code from clangDriver into new clangOptions library" (#167348) backend:AArch64 backend:AMDGPU backend:ARM backend:CSKY backend:Hexagon backend:loongarch backend:MIPS backend:PowerPC backend:RISC-V backend:Sparc backend:SPIR-V backend:SystemZ backend:X86 bazel "Peripheral" support tier build system: utils/bazel clang:driver 'clang' and 'clang++' user-facing binaries. Not 'clang-cl' clang:frontend Language frontend issues, e.g. anything involving "Sema" clang:openmp OpenMP related changes to Clang clang Clang issues not falling into any other category clang-tools-extra clangd flang:driver flang Flang issues not falling into any other category lldb llvm:mc Machine (object) code
#167374 by naveen-seth was merged Nov 10, 2025 Loading… updated Nov 11, 2025
Remove unused standard header inclusion: <iterator>, <utility>, <type_traits> backend:AArch64 backend:AMDGPU backend:ARM backend:Hexagon backend:NVPTX backend:RISC-V backend:SPIR-V backend:SystemZ backend:X86 debuginfo llvm:adt llvm:analysis Includes value tracking, cost tables and constant folding llvm:binary-utilities llvm:codegen llvm:instcombine Covers the InstCombine, InstSimplify and AggressiveInstCombine passes llvm:ir llvm:mc Machine (object) code llvm:regalloc llvm:support llvm:transforms PGO Profile Guided Optimizations platform:windows tablegen tools:llvm-exegesis xray
#167318 by serge-sans-paille was closed Nov 11, 2025 Loading… updated Nov 11, 2025
Previous Next
ProTip! Type g i on any issue or pull request to go back to the issue listing page.